"Ideally situated to explore, shame about the contractors and building work."
The hotel is ideally situated next to the rail line which could be heard from our room but it was definitely not intrusive.
Building work is currently taking place at Harrogate south hotel and contractors vehicles were parked directly outside our bedroom window causing us both privacy issues and noise disturbances. These same vehicles were repeatedly parking in the disability spaces making them unavailable for those like myself who needed to use them. In addition to this the back entrance of the hotel reception (closest to the disabled parking bays) was also blocked off to hotel users on one day meaning all visitors had to use the front entrance. It appeared to us that no consideration was made to those with mobility issues.
A skip was dropped off about 5 am this which woke us both up.
And the icing on the cake was a huge downpour of water lasting in excess of 15-20 mins was unleashed during this incredibly noisy morning. We later learned that this was a water tank in the hotel being emptied all over one side of the hotel. Unbelievable.
I am happy to report that all staff we kind and accommodating and were very working hard

"Worst ever experience at a Premier Inn"
On the day of my stay, the hotel was at 100% occupancy, it being a Bank Holiday weekend, and this had a bad effect on service levels. The management has evidently cut staff levels to the bare bone, with the same individual single-handedly operating Reception and running other services like the Restaurant and Room Service at the same time.
There was no toilet paper in my bathroom. (It was replenished by staff on entry to room.)
There were no mugs or glasses in the room. (I had to ask for them.)
There was no fresh bath towel. What looked like the previous occupant's towel was still hanging on the rail. I couldn't ask for a fresh towel, as staff were unavailable. Therefore, I was unable to shower.
The room was very cold at 16C. It took several hours to heat up to an acceptable 21C.
The dining room was busy when I arrived at my allotted dining time and there was nowhere for me to sit, and no member of staff to greet me and seat me. I had to go away for 30 minutes and return later.
A group of drunken, raucous guests dominated the dining area with their loud shouting at dinner. It was unpleasant for other, quieter guests to be in their presence.
The dining room was grossly under-staffed. I had to wait 40 minutes for my main course. I had ordered Tagliatelle with a tomato and chilli sauce. When it arrived it was small enough to be a child's portion - possibly 40g or 50g of dry pasta. It was just slopped into the bowl and no Parmesan cheese was offered by the Server. They didn't approach me to ask if I was having dessert; I had to catch the Server as she passed in order to get my pre-paid dessert. Other diners complained that their food orders never arrived, even after a long wait.
BREAKFAST: The same group of raucous guests was still dominating the room at breakfast. I had to take a seat as far away from them as possible to avoid being deafened by their shouting.
The hotel was extremely under-staffed; extremely slow service; very poor attention to detail in rooms; lack of cleanliness/provision of basics such as loo paper and clean towels.
